#298844 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#298844 is composed of 16.1% red, 53.3%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 50%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 137.1 degrees, a saturation of 53.7% and a lightness of 34.7%. #298844 color hex could be obtained by blending #52ff88 with #001100.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#298844 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#298844 has RGB values of R:41, G:136,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0, Y:0.5,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 2721860.

Shades and Tints of #298844
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f0fbf3 is the lightest one.
